#3486e7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3486e7 is composed of 20.4% red, 52.5%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 212.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 55.5%. #3486e7 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#000dcf.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#3486e7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3486e7 has RGB values of R:52, G:134, B:231 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3442407.

Hex triplet 3486e7 #3486e7
RGB Decimal 52, 134, 231 rgb(52,134,231)
RGB Percent 20.4, 52.5, 90.6 rgb(20.4%,52.5%,90.6%)
CMYK 77, 42, 0, 9
HSL 212.5°, 78.9, 55.5 hsl(212.5,78.9%,55.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 212.5°, 77.5, 90.6
Web Safe 3399ff #3399ff
CIE-LAB 55.632, 8.85, -56.104
XYZ 24.362, 23.548, 78.858
xyY 0.192, 0.186, 23.548
CIE-LCH 55.632, 56.798, 278.964
CIE-LUV 55.632, -28.329, -89.143
Hunter-Lab 48.526, 4.693, -62.382
Binary 00110100, 10000110, 11100111

Shades and Tints of #3486e7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010407 is the darkest color, while #f5f9fe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#3486e7 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#797979 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6b7c8f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5e88e5 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#328de7 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#0099a3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4f87e5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#338ae7 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1292bb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
